==Majka Kwiatowska (1949)==




Polish painter. Graduated from the Warsaw Fine
Arts Academy, she has also attended the Académie
des Beaux Arts in Paris on a scholarship.


The end of her studies was contemporaneous with
the outset of the events, which came to change the
whole political landscape of Eastern Europe. While
taking an active part in the Movement of
Independent Culture by organizing clandestine
exhibits and artistic events as well as the aid
for painters and sculptors, she have developed her
personal style: after a gray period, expressing
the atmosphere of these difficult years, subtle
colors later made their appearance – they filter
a secret light that captivates the spectator.
Her abstract painting further elaborate the
perspectives first explored by Mark Rothko. A
subtle force and emotional tension emanate from
her pieces; a veil darkening the soul enfolds
them, but an internal light prevails in the end. 


Majka Kwiatowska has been awarded various prizes,
notably the Polish Association for the Visual
Arts’ Gold Medal (1993).  Her paintings are
exhibited in the prestigious collections of The
Polish National Library in Warsaw, The Warsaw City
Hall and The Museum of the Warsaw Archdiocese.
They can be found in private collections all over
the world.


“Perhaps a poet could best express what is most
important in this work. I am not a poet, but I
would like to write a few words on this painting.
It has interested me for a long time; it is not an
easy world. Apparently, it does not contain much.
But it does palpitate with a clear, strong life…
This beautiful painting possesses both force and
delicacy. It holds the artist’s internal
dialogue with herself and also a kind of revolt…
The exceptional faculty to tie elements together
characterizes these paintings. Links appear as if
involuntarily, as if by chance. I know what this
hides. To attain such an effect, one must go
through hundreds of attempts – one must paint
and paint again reaching for a particular state
when every-thing begins to slowly ripen, order
itself, adjust to the artist, becomes clear,
evident.”

 -- Academy of Fine Arts Prof. Jacek Sienicki
(1999)
